Section 11-92C-9 Bonds of authority. (a) Source of payment. All bonds issued by an authority shall be payable solely out of the revenues and receipts derived from the leasing or sale by the board of its projects, or from any other source as may be designated in the proceedings of the board under which the bonds are authorized to be issued. (b) Pledge of revenues, receipts, and other security. The principal and interest on any bonds issued by an authority shall be secured by a pledge of the revenues and receipts out of which the principal and interest may be payable and may be secured by a mortgage and deed of trust or trust indenture conveying as security for the bonds all or any part of the property of the authority from which the revenues or receipts so pledged may be derived. Section 14-2-21 Bonds - Security. The principal of, premium, if any, and interest on the bonds of the authority shall be secured by any or all of the following, as the authority may determine: (1) The rent and revenue for the use of one or more facilities of the authority; (2) The net rent or sale proceeds from the Kilby property; (3) Any bond proceeds remaining unexpended upon completion of all facilities to be constructed with such bond proceeds and the payment of the cost thereof; (4) Any insurance proceeds which the authority may receive by reason of its ownership of any of the facilities; and (5) Any mortgage upon or security interest in one or more facilities of the authority, granted in connection with the issuance of such bonds. The authority shall have authority to transfer and assign any lease of any of the facilities and any lease or mortgage of the Kilby property as security for the payment of such principal, premium, if any, and interest.
